Water Baptism

Text: Acts 8:36-40   IBCSS   May 16, 2004

Preacher: Pastor Jose B. Cabajar

    Water baptism is a Biblical teaching and a sacred practice of true Christians. Its importance is strongly illustrated through immersion. The death, burial and resurrection of the Lord Jesus Christ are always portrayed through this God-pleasing activity.

    A true Christian who truly understands the teaching of baptism will surely look forward to the day he will be baptized and it will be a memorable day for him. As he ponders his baptism he will be led to respect, love and guard his beliefs and practices. His love for the Savior will be significantly manifested through his separated life in Christ.

    On the other side, a professing believer who ignores and avoid Biblical baptism will hinder his spiritual advancement. Worst of all, he could be a person with questionable faith and unbiblical principles of life.

    In Acts 8:36, the Ethiopian eunuch was really excited to be baptized and he really meant it when he said to Philip, “See here is water; what doth hinder me to be baptized?”

(I) Greatly Desire By True Believers

     Acts 8:36

    -Godly desires excite a believer

    -Godly desires lead a believer to the right path

   He who by faith received the Lord Jesus will never question Christ’s death, burial and resurrection, but will have the desire to proclaim the message of the Gospel through water baptism. People who have struggles when it comes to water baptism are certainly those who don’t even mind to ponder on the importance of baptism.

    Professing believers who are not interested in obeying the call of baptism are also those who are not excited about the Word of God. The Ethiopian eunuch was so interested in the Scriptures that he got saved through the preaching of Philip. His newly found faith in Christ stirred his heart and intensely led him to desire water baptism. Truly, a man who knows the preciousness of his faith in Jesus knows also the great significance of water baptism.

(II) Believer's Step Of Faith And Obedience

      Acts 8:37-38    Matthew 28:18-20

     -Crucial step

     -God-pleasing step

   Apparently, many people profess they are saved, but they refuse to be baptized. Undecided people usually leave their heart and mind hanging in the air, tossed to and fro by the winds of unsound doctrine.

    True believers know whom they follow. They hear the voice of their Master and follow Him without reservations. Their crucial steps are being ordered by the Lord and their obedience to His Word gives honor and glory to God.

(III) Believer's Identification With The Savior

       Acts 8:37      Romans 6:1-9

      -Spiritual identity

      -Profession of faith

   As we live in the midst of disoriented world, man’s spiritual identity is an important matter not to be taken lightly, but seriously. Genuine Christians must have the courage to stand on the Lord’s side.

    Biblical water baptism sharpens the clarity of one’s faith in Christ and should not be neglected, but be emphasized publicly. A professing believer who is ashamed to obey the call of water baptism is a questionable believer.

   We must bear in mind that our blessed association with the Lord Jesus Christ is something to be proud of. 

(IV) Brings forth Rejoicing

       Acts 8:39-40     Acts 16:33-34

       -Gives delight to the soul

   Obedience to the Word of God brings forth rejoicing and blessings, but disobedience to the principles of Truth leads a man to grief and guilt. In many cases, people are avoiding the blessings of Truth through their indifferent attitude toward the doctrines of the Bible.

    This simple lesson on baptism, if deeply studied and understood, will surely bear good fruits for the glory of God. The death, burial and resurrection of Christ will always be remembered and appreciated in the hearts of men. Keeping this Biblical knowledge and practice in our lives will undoubtedly separate and guard us from the threatening presence of false teachers and doctrines.
